2009-07-14 8 views

Répondre

5

Nous ne pouvons pas vraiment vous donner une réponse définitive ici. Le Compact Framework fonctionne sur beaucoup de matériel. Comme un excellent exemple, je travaille sur des applications CF sur une base presque quotidienne, et je rarement utiliser un appareil Windows Mobile. En fait, je viens d'installer le SDK WinMo 6.x sur mon ordinateur portable, et je l'utilise depuis 3 ans pour le développement. Il n'y a simplement pas d'appareil "moyen".

La question que vous devez vous poser est "qu'est-ce qu'un exemple représentatif du type d'appareil que je prévois de cibler?" Si vous voulez cibler des PDA/téléphones, alors j'obtiendrais probablement un téléphone WinMo 5.0 pour une utilisation générale puisqu'il y a une grande base d'installation et que les applications 5.0 fonctionneront sous 6.x.

Si vous envisagez de cibler des périphériques embarqués, un bon CEPC polyvalent comme un eBox 3300 est pratique car il démarre déjà sous Windows CE.

Si vous envisagez d'utiliser des E/S, vous devez vraiment regarder un périphérique beaucoup plus proche du matériel réel que vous souhaitez cibler. En fait, vous voudrez probablement qu'il soit construit sur votre BSP cible, car les E/S sont très processeurs, et dépendent souvent des OEM.

+0

+1. J'ai moi-même beaucoup de cicatrices de combat de Compact Framework, parfois infligées indirectement par un BSP OEM bogué. –

1

Non relié au matériel principal, mais toujours très pertinent, est une bonne collection de différentes cartes de stockage/périphériques de différentes vitesses. Par exemple, si votre carte de développement a un slot pour carte SD, assurez-vous que vous avez des cartes SD dans une variété de vitesses et de performances. Cela peut faire une grande différence dans la performance :)

3

Je suggère deux appareils: HTC Touch PRO, et un Motorola Q. Le HTC Touch Pro a toutes les fonctionnalités de l'appareil mobile que vous pourriez rechercher (écran tactile, gps, clavier matériel, et wi-fi). Le Motorola Q est juste le contraire (pas d'écran tactile, pas de GPS [selon le modèle]). Aussi avec le HTC Touch PRO, il existe des communautés qui peuvent vous aider à installer une nouvelle version de Windows Mobile sur l'appareil. Deux qui viennent à l'esprit sont PPC Geeks (www.ppcgeeks.com) et XDA (xda-developers.com).

Je crois que Motorola Q a le même type de communautés, mais je n'ai pas ces liens. Ces deux appareils vous permettront de démarrer votre développement Windows Mobile.

Questions connexes